Masturbating In Presence Of Another Sufficient To Infer Sexual Intent: Mumbai Court

A Mumbai court, while hearing a case of child sex abuse, held that masturbation in the presence of another person is sufficient to infer sexual intent of an accused. With this, the court convicted a 60-year-old in the aforementioned child sex abuse case. A complaint filed under the POCSO Act states that, the accused flashed to the victim, while masturbating in front of him.
